If I could do it then I am pretty sure you can. It was the paperwork sorting that took the time & you have to do that anyway. Have a read on the death, funeral & probate threads & see what you think. Provided you know there are no debts you can cut 6 months off the process (especially if the only beneficiaries are executors too). It can be a real eyeopener.
